Pass Rate Trend Comparison
MOT pass rate by year the vehicle was manufactured, based on DVSA test data (2005–2024)
📊 View as table
| Built | Mazda CX-3 | Nissan Juke |
|---|---|---|
| 2021 | — | 90.9% |
| 2020 | 87.2% | 87.0% |
| 2019 | 90.9% | 84.9% |
| 2018 | 90.5% | 85.3% |
| 2017 | 89.4% | 84.1% |
| 2016 | 85.2% | 80.9% |
| 2015 | 84.3% | 78.1% |
| 2014 | — | 75.2% |
| 2013 | — | 70.2% |
| 2012 | — | 71.5% |
| 2011 | — | 70.5% |
| 2010 | — | 70.2% |
Based on DVSA anonymised MOT test data (2005–2024). Crown copyright, Open Government Licence v3.0.
